Disclaimer # 2: I have never followed a recipe in my life therefore I do not expect you to either! The following is a very loose guideline (I don't actually measure when I make it, I just eyeball), so feel free to do whatever proportions you like :)

 2-3 Spoonfuls 0% plain greek yogurt

1-2 Tbsp peanut butter

1 Banana

3/4 cup frozen berries

Optional:

Add: protein powder (chocolate)

Oats

Granola

Chia seeds

Cinnamon

PrOATein Bar (chopped up)

Put it all in a bowl/Tupperwear and in the fridge overnight, or in your bag if you are on the go. The berries thaw nicely :) In this one I added a chocolate fudge flavour PrOATein Bar for that indulgent taste.
